capronic

/kæprɒnɪk/

Definitions

1. adjective

Relating to or characteristic of caproic acid, a carboxylic acid found in the fatty portion of milk and various animal products.

“Capronic esters are commonly used in the production of fragrances and cosmetics.”

2. noun

A caproic acid or a compound derived from it.

“The chemist isolated a capronic compound from the fatty acids in the milk.”
